Tornado Damage Trail Maintenance at O'Fallon Park
We JUST cleared the trails in this park on May 7 and now the tornado has devastated these trails. This is a great opportunity to do some trail maintenance work. If you have not done this work before, this is a wonderful way to learn. We will be cutting trees and clearing brush. All tools will be provided by the Sierra Club. We will be working with the St. Louis City Parks, Ozark Trail Association and River City Outdoors (a group with a mission to provide opportunities to urban youth to connect with nature). Participants can work as many hours as they want. No Pets, please. Guns are prohibited.
